While there were four divisions of the first leg of the Exit 16W Series at the Meadowlands Friday night, the Cape & Cutter, a winter classic for pacing mares, needed only two opening splits.
The first went to Higher And Higher, who prevailed by nose over Oceans Motion in 1:52.1. There were just seven horses in the field, with a two-horse Burke Stable entry. Daryl Bier owns, trains and drives Higher And Higher, a 5-year-old mare by Western Terror who has now won all three of her Meadowlands starts this season.
The Burke Stable got its Cape & Cutter victory in the second split As veteran Ginger And Fred coasted across the wire 1 1/4 lengths in front of Royal Cee Cee N in 1:50.4. Ginger And Fred, a 6-year-old mare by Real Artist, was beaten by Higher And Higher by a head in her previous Big M start.
